About N-[4-(4-fluorophenyl)-5-[2-(4-piperazin-1-ylanilino)pyrimidin-4-yl]-1,3-thiazol-2-yl]cyclopropanecarboxamide

N-[4-(4-fluorophenyl)-5-[2-(4-piperazin-1-ylanilino)pyrimidin-4-yl]-1,3-thiazol-2-yl]cyclopropanecarboxamide (PubChem CID 155560462) has the molecular formula C27H26FN7OS and a molecular weight of 515.62 g/mol. Its IUPAC name is N-[4-(4-fluorophenyl)-5-[2-(4-piperazin-1-ylanilino)pyrimidin-4-yl]-1,3-thiazol-2-yl]cyclopropanecarboxamide.
